Phosphatidylcholine Market Summary

As per MRFR analysis, the Phosphatidylcholine Market Size was estimated at 3.404 USD Billion in 2024. The Phosphatidylcholine industry is projected to grow from 3.527 USD Billion in 2025 to 5.029 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 3.61 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

Advancements in Pharmaceutical Applications

Phosphatidylcholine Market is increasingly being utilized in pharmaceutical formulations, particularly in drug delivery systems. Its biocompatibility and ability to enhance the solubility of poorly soluble drugs make it a valuable component in the phosphatidylcholine market. Recent studies indicate that the incorporation of phosphatidylcholine in liposomal formulations can significantly improve therapeutic efficacy. This trend is expected to drive growth, as pharmaceutical companies seek innovative solutions to enhance drug delivery and patient outcomes. The market for phosphatidylcholine in pharmaceuticals is projected to grow, reflecting the ongoing advancements in drug formulation technologies.

Pharmaceutical Grade (Dominant) vs. Cosmetic Grade (Emerging)

Pharmaceutical Grade phosphatidylcholine is recognized for its high purity and stringent manufacturing standards, making it a dominant player in the market. It is widely utilized in various applications, including intravenous drugs and liposomal formulations, ensuring effective drug delivery and enhanced bioavailability. On the other hand, Cosmetic Grade phosphatidylcholine is emerging as a significant segment as the cosmetic industry grows and the demand for natural and effective skincare products rises. Its ability to hydrate and nourish the skin makes it increasingly attractive to cosmetic brands and consumers alike, fostering innovation and product development in this space.

Regional Insights

North America : Innovation and Demand Surge

North America is the largest market for phosphatidylcholine, holding approximately 40% of the global share. The region's growth is driven by increasing demand in the food and pharmaceutical sectors, alongside regulatory support for health supplements. The rising awareness of health benefits associated with phosphatidylcholine is further propelling market expansion. The United States is the primary contributor, with significant investments from key players like Avanti Polar Lipids, Inc. and Cargill, Incorporated. Canada also plays a vital role, focusing on research and development in lipid-based products. The competitive landscape is characterized by innovation and strategic partnerships among leading companies.

Europe : Regulatory Support and Growth

Europe is the second-largest market for phosphatidylcholine, accounting for around 30% of the global share. The region benefits from stringent regulations that promote the use of phosphatidylcholine in food and dietary supplements. The increasing consumer preference for natural and functional foods is driving demand, supported by initiatives from the European Food Safety Authority. Germany and France are leading countries in this market, with a strong presence of companies like BASF SE and Lipoid GmbH. The competitive landscape is marked by innovation in product formulations and a focus on sustainability. The region's regulatory framework encourages research and development, fostering a robust market environment.
